Research Abstract

Because determination of the energy budget is key to understanding the physics of earthquakes, quantitative evaluation of the energy taken up by coseismic chemical reaction is important. I performed chemical analysis of fault-rock sample from natural seismogenic faults, and revealed the signals indicating the coseismic reaction were found. By a numerical analysis incorporating thermal property measurement, chemical kinetics, and energy conservation, I evaluated the energy taken up by the reaction.
